Subject: [PATCH] mshv: fix hv_input_get_system_property struct
Date: Tue, 30 Jun 2026 14:57:54 -0700	[thread overview]
Message-ID: <20260630215754.200779-1-wei.liu@kernel.org> (raw)

From: Wei Liu <wei.liu@kernel.org>

Keep it in sync with the correct definition.

The old code worked by chance.

Cc: stable@kernel.org
Signed-off-by: Wei Liu <wei.liu@kernel.org>
---
 include/hyperv/hvhdk_mini.h | 3 ++-
 1 file changed, 2 insertions(+), 1 deletion(-)

diff --git a/include/hyperv/hvhdk_mini.h b/include/hyperv/hvhdk_mini.h
index b4cb2fa26e9b..035ba20870f7 100644
--- a/include/hyperv/hvhdk_mini.h
+++ b/include/hyperv/hvhdk_mini.h
@@ -184,8 +184,9 @@ enum hv_dynamic_processor_feature_property {
 
 struct hv_input_get_system_property {
 	u32 property_id; /* enum hv_system_property */
+	u32 reserved;
 	union {
-		u32 as_uint32;
+		u64 as_uint64;
 #if IS_ENABLED(CONFIG_X86)
 		/* enum hv_dynamic_processor_feature_property */
 		u32 hv_processor_feature;
